Output 61d70662d7e98385c756a274c340f66d16133f1425a7072eb602ec7c74f2eaac:1

value
15100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45931c632d17fd932b8271b6dc564e77acccf59a OP_EQUALVERIFY OP_CHECKSIG
address
17LsrgSZc836qhDQ532XEdumEs7XuSkkkr
transaction
61d70662d7e98385c756a274c340f66d16133f1425a7072eb602ec7c74f2eaac
spent
true